Who needs student rights at school?

01
All students attending the school need student rights. These rights ensure fair treatment, protection, and equal opportunities for all students. It allows them to express their opinions, participate in decision-making processes, and have a voice in matters that affect their education and well-being. Student rights also serve as a mechanism to address grievances, resolve conflicts, and foster a positive learning environment within the school.
